Megan Carey (@meganecarey) 's Twitter Profile Photo

🔉Out today in Communications Biology - our genomic analysis of earliest H58 S. Typhi organisms isolated from returning travellers to the UK suggests this highly successful lineage emerged in 1987 in India, likely from a chronic carrier, and was already MDR. nature.com/articles/s4200…

LSHTM AMR Centre (@lshtm_amr) 's Twitter Profile Photo

New research alert 🔔 A study in The Lancet Microbe by Zoe Anne Dyson reveals high levels of drug-resistant typhoid in Bangladesh, Nepal, and Malawi. Calls for increased focus on vaccination and WASH to combat this public health threat. Read more👇 bit.ly/45X8mz0
